Homeschool Program K - 12 | Homeschool High School Courses
SponsoredPersonalized Home Learning With Teacher Support. You Don't Have to Homeschoo…Site visitors: Over 10K in the past monthLearn to Read Online | ABCmouse.com | Award Winning Learning
SponsoredDesigned by learning experts, your child can practice math, reading, phonics, and …